In spite of its name, the Westside neighborhood sits in a fairly central location among Atlantic City’s various resources and attractions. Atlantic Avenue, the beach, and the coastal casinos are all within easy walking distance to the south; the Borgata (with its numerous moth-watering dining options) sits on the north end; and the Atlantic City Convention Center, the rail terminal, and much of the local shopping lies just southwest of the neighborhood.
Within the community, folks enjoy a quiet, mostly-residential atmosphere. A few small corner markets and delis keep the population well-fed and well-supplied. Several public parks and schools are scattered throughout the neighborhood as well, making it easy to get around on foot.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
